How to Measure Your Space for Accurate Countertop Material Estimation
Accurate measurements are the foundation of a precise countertop material takeoff. At One Ten Estimations, we help contractors, builders, and homeowners calculate the exact amount of material needed for quartz, granite, marble, and other stone surfaces, ensuring your project stays on budget and avoids waste.
Follow these steps for the most accurate results:
- Sketch Your Layout: Create a detailed outline of your countertop area. Include L-shaped, U-shaped, galley designs, or islands. This helps our team visualize your space and plan material requirements.
- Measure Each Section: Record the length and width of each countertop section in inches. For irregular shapes, break the area into rectangles or triangles to ensure precise measurement.
- Convert to Square Feet: Multiply length × width for each section, then divide by 144 to convert from square inches to square feet. This allows our estimators to calculate exact slab quantities.
- Include Extras: Note islands, backsplashes, overhangs, and specialty cutouts for sinks, stoves, or cooktops. Accounting for these details prevents material shortages and ensures seamless installation.
- Double-Check Measurements: Always measure twice to avoid errors. Even small inaccuracies can impact material takeoff, potentially causing over-ordering or delays.
- Provide Your Plans: Share your measurements, sketches, or blueprints with our team. The more details we have, the more accurate your countertop material estimation report will be.
